Quota Attainment
The proportion of quota a rep achieved, and across a team, the distribution of that proportion.
The measure and its summary
Actual revenue against assigned target, per seller, per period. The headline is usually reported as an average, which is the least informative summary available.
Report the distribution
What to report instead
Share of sellers at or above target — the single most honest summary.
The full distribution, or at least quartiles. Shape carries the information.
Attainment against territory potential, plotted as a scatter. The vertical spread is performance; the horizontal spread is design.
Attainment by tenure cohort, so ramping sellers are not averaged with fully ramped ones.
Diagnosing a wide spread
Check potential dispersion across territories first. If potential varies threefold, so will attainment, and no coaching addresses that.
Check the target derivation. Quotas derived from prior attainment carry forward the previous imbalance and compound it each year.
Check tenure. A spread driven by ramping sellers is a hiring-schedule artefact, not a performance finding.
Only then look at individual performance, on the residual after the first three are accounted for.
What it cannot tell you
Nothing about the quality of the revenue — attainment made up of heavily discounted deals counts the same.
Nothing absolute, since it is a ratio to a number someone chose. Raising targets lowers attainment without anything changing on the ground.
Nothing about timing within the period, which is where compensation structure exerts most of its influence.

Capacity Planning
Translating a revenue target into the number of productive selling resources required to hit it, accounting for ramp, attrition and expected attainment.
Ramp Time
The time between a seller starting and reaching expected productivity. The variable that makes hiring plans wrong when it is guessed rather than measured.
Quota
The revenue target assigned to an individual rep for a period. The most consequential number in a seller's working life, and the mechanism translating a company target into individual accountability.
COMMON QUESTIONS
- What is a healthy quota attainment distribution?
- A concentration around target with a modest tail either side. A wide spread, or a bimodal shape, usually indicates a territory or quota design problem before it indicates a talent problem.
- Why is average attainment misleading?
- Because a few large overachievers can carry the average while most of the team misses. The share of sellers at or above target is a more honest summary than the mean.
- Does low attainment mean the team is underperforming?
- Not necessarily. Attainment is actual over target, so it falls when targets rise faster than capacity. Check the target derivation before concluding anything about the sellers.
- How does territory design affect attainment?
- Directly. Where territories differ materially in potential, attainment differences partly measure the map rather than the seller — which is why potential dispersion should be checked before attainment is used to rank anyone.
